#include #include #include using namespace std; #define RREP(i,s,e) for (int i = e-1; i >= s; i--) #define rrep(i,n) RREP(i,0,n) #define REP(i,s,e) for (int i = s; i < e; i++) #define rep(i,n) REP(i,0,n) int main() { int n, sum, height, ans; cin >> n; int a[n]; rep (i,n) cin >> a[i]; sum = accumulate(a,a+n,0); height = sqrt(sum); ans = 0; rep (i,min(n,height*2 - 1)) ans += max(0, a[i] - min(i+1,height*2 - 1 - i)); REP (i,height*2 - 1,n) ans += a[i]; cout << ans << endl; return 0; }